I do beta! I'm good at noticing words or phrases that are repeated too often; I'm pretty good at grammar. & I'm good at slicing out excess verbiage. I'm less good at seeing big-picture stuff: how the overall plot moves, is paced, etc. ... these pretty much mirror my strengths/weaknesses w/writing my own fic, ha!
